About M.G. Clement
M.G. Clement is a scholar working on Physiology, Pulmonary and Respiratory Medicine, Endocrine and Autonomic Systems, Cardiology and Cardiovascular Medicine and Molecular Biology, having authored 58 papers that have together received 757 indexed citations. Recurring topics across this work include Nitric Oxide and Endothelin Effects (21 papers), Neuroscience of respiration and sleep (17 papers), Heart Rate Variability and Autonomic Control (9 papers), Pulmonary Hypertension Research and Treatments (9 papers), Respiratory Support and Mechanisms (8 papers), Pharmacological Effects and Assays (6 papers), Asthma and respiratory diseases (5 papers) and Eicosanoids and Hypertension Pharmacology (4 papers). The work is most often cited by research in Endocrine and Autonomic Systems (98 citations), Dermatology (99 citations), Equine (18 citations), Cell Biology (154 citations) and Sensory Systems (38 citations). M.G. Clement has collaborated with scholars based in Italy, Canada and Switzerland. Frequent co-authors include M. Albertini, J.‐P. Ortonne, Édith Aberdam, Robert Ballotti, Jacopo P. Mortola, G Sant'Ambrogio, Silvia Mazzola, Maria Laura Bacci, Monica Forni and Fabio Gentilini. Their work appears in journals such as Prostaglandins Leukotrienes and Essential Fatty Acids, Veterinary Research Communications, Journal of Applied Physiology, The FASEB Journal and The Anatomical Record.
